For this week's theme, I quilled a quill. As a nod to Shakespeare's talent with words, here is some word trivia for you:
Supposedly, back in the middle ages, French nuns ripped gilded edges off old prayer book pages and rolled them on a quill to create various shapes, emulating decorative ironwork. With these scrolls and shapes, they decorated covers of new prayer books. Hence we get the word "quilling" for this craft. Have a look here at some antique quilling.
